TURN-208: Gatevale turnstile counters at the Merrow Field pilot double-count when a rotation reverses mid-cycle. Attendance totals drift roughly 2% high per event. The debounce window fix is implemented, reviewed by Ilsa, and soak-tested across two simulated match days without drift. Ready for your cut; the candidate build is identified below.

trace token, tagag-tafog: htk6_5ed18c

Ticket: Staging env misconfigured for Siftgate bloom filter

The bloom layer in front of the Pellet KV store is rejecting all lookups in staging because the env file was copied from the dev template without credentials. False-positive tuning values are fine; only the auth line is missing. To unblock the weekly demo, the Pellet admission secret must be set on the following line.

env line for yaguf-fajop: LEDGER_TOKEN13=fb08984397349

- [ ] Verify log sampling on the Brindlecast notifier service. Confirm sample rate is 1:50 for INFO, 1:1 for ERROR. Check that the sampler config survived last week's redeploy and that dropped-line counters are exported. If volume still exceeds quota, page the service owner before tightening further. The owner of record follows.

named custodian: Brivan Eliath Quenox Frador

- [ ] **Step 7: Breaker override escrow.** After sealing the signing keys for the Tallgrove upstream API circuit breaker, confirm the support team can force the breaker open during a full outage. The override bundle lives in the sealed escrow drawer and is useless without its unlock phrase. Two ceremony witnesses must initial this step before proceeding. The escrow bundle is decrypted with the recovery passphrase that follows.

vault phrase of kahip-kahop = holath-quenmir

**Action Item 7 (owner: Priya on the Kilnworks team):** Our GPU memory profiler currently runs with broad node access, which is overkill and made this incident harder to audit. We need to scope it down to read-only device queries and add an access log. Draft threat model and the proposed permission set are written up on the internal review page.

operations page: https://jenkins.zemvarcloud.local/job/merge_requests/repo/build/73930b4b30f0a8ed